:) Looking for a Nitro gear case for a 55 hp 45 cid Evinrude/Johnson. It is the 2.42:1 ratio with more than 4 spline teeth on vertical shaft. Must be in good running condition. Will be at Dunville Aug. 15th, 16th & 17th, and can pay for, and pick it up then.

:) What are you asking? The straight skeg is not what we use in T-7560/850 due to boat spin out in turns. So we will have to cut off skeg and weld on swept back skeg.
